Smithfield Station is a boutique style, family owned and operated waterfront Hotel, Restaurant and Marina located on the banks of the Pagan River in historic downtown Smithfield, VA.

Our hotel is divided in to four categories, the lodge, the lighthouse, the boardwalk and the original building.

The Lodge at Smithfield Station is our newest addition. Opened in September 2007, the new Lodge offers 22 high end, boutique style rooms. All rooms are waterfront and all but two have private balconies. All rooms in the Lodge are non smoking, feature king size beds, fireplaces, granite counters, tile showers (no bathtubs) and upscale amenities.

Our lighthouse was modeled after the Hooper Strait Light in Maryland, now located at the Maritime Museum in St. Michaels, MD, the Light at Smithfield is an exact replica of a working Chesapeake Bay Style Lighthouse. The upstairs suite is the Capt. Sinclair Honeymoon Suite and the downstairs is the Capt. Todd Executive Suite. Each has its own uniqueness about it and is sure to cure whatever ails you.

The Boardwalk Rooms and Cottages are located along the boardwalk between the Lighthouse and the Original Building. These unique rooms are truly waterfront as they sit anywhere from six to twenty feet from the marina and all are on the first floor.

The original building, as its name implies, is the original structure built on the property. This building houses the Smithfield Station restaurant as well as 15 hotel rooms. The exterior of the Station is modeled after the old Coast Guard life saving stations that proliferated the coast of Virginia and Outer Banks of North Carolina.
